Finance Act 2025 overhauls Section 82 of Customs Act 1969
Karachi, June 29, 2025 – The Finance Act, 2025 has brought a comprehensive revision to Section 82 of the Customs Act, 1969, significantly altering the procedure regarding goods that are not cleared, warehoused, transshipped, exported, or removed from port premises after their unloading or declaration.

New customs tariff slabs to take effect from July 1, 2025
ISLAMABAD – In a sweeping overhaul of the import duty regime, the government has revised Customs laws through amended Finance Bill, 2025 to implement a revised structure of tariff slabs, effective from July 1, 2025. The move is part of a broader tariff rationalization plan aimed at streamlining import costs, encouraging trade, and aligning with global best practices.
